Plumber: what does he do?

The plumber is the professional figure responsible for the installation, maintenance and repair of water pipes and sanitary and sanitary systems, in civil and industrial construction, as well as in road construction.

In addition to designing and installing the plumbing system, studying the right arrangement of pipes, connections, taps, meters, drains, pumps and pressurizers, necessary in case of bathroom and kitchen renovation, plumbers also deal with heating and air conditioning systems. and conduction of water and steam, underfloor, wall and ceiling heating systems, high-efficiency gas condensing and pellet boilers, heat pump and air exchange systems, drinking water supply, irrigation, waste water disposal or drainage. Hydraulic interventions:

To recap: what does the plumber do? Here are the most common plumbing jobs:

Faucet installation and repair

Unclogging of pipes and sinks

Installation and maintenance of sanitary ware

Installation and maintenance of the boiler, siphons and water heaters
Design and install sanitation facilities
Installation and maintenance of the heating system
Installation and maintenance of the air conditioning system
Ordinary and extraordinary maintenance of drains and systems

How much does a plumber cost?

Now that we know what a plumber does, let’s move on to pricing. How much does a plumber cost?

The hourly plumbing cost is on average between $ 20 and $ 45 for an hour of work but can increase for an emergency response, especially if outside working hours, during the night or on a public holiday.
